J.L.B. Y Cía is a popular Mexican tropical music group that originated in Sabinas, Coahuila, in 1982. The band is named after its founder and lead vocalist, José Luis Beltrán, and over the years, they have become well-known for their vibrant cumbia rhythms and lively performances. Their sound blends traditional tropical styles with modern touches, making them favorites at dances and festivals across Mexico. They have released numerous albums, including live sessions and greatest hits collections, showcasing their enduring appeal and dynamic stage presence.
Their music is often featured at local celebrations, such as in the town of Parás, Nuevo León, where J.L.B. Y Cía's orchestra-style performances complement traditional festivities alongside Norteno bands. This highlights their role as a staple in Mexican regional music scenes, bringing energy and joy to gatherings with hits like “La Flaca” and “Amparito.” Whether playing live or recording in the studio, J.L.B. Y Cía continues to keep the rich tradition of Mexican tropical music alive for new generations.
